Какие варианты настраиваемых режимов доступны при установке связи в базе данных? 1)режим автоматического сохранения
Какие варианты настраиваемых режимов доступны при установке связи в базе данных? 1)режим автоматического сохранения изменений 2)режим автоматического удаления связанных объектов 3)режим автоматической замены связанных значений
24.11.2023 22:12
Описание: При установке связи в базе данных мы можем выбрать различные настраиваемые режимы. Вот три основных варианта, которые доступны:
1) Режим автоматического сохранения изменений: В этом режиме любые изменения, внесенные в связанные объекты, будут автоматически сохраняться в базе данных без необходимости явного вызова команды сохранения. Это удобно, когда требуется автоматическое сохранение изменений.
2) Режим автоматического удаления связанных объектов: В этом режиме, при удалении объекта из базы данных, все связанные с ним объекты также будут автоматически удалены. Это особенно полезно, когда требуется поддерживать целостность базы данных.
3) Режим автоматической замены связанных значений: В этом режиме, если изменяется значение связанного объекта, то все ссылки на это значение в других объектах будут автоматически обновляться. Это удобно, когда требуется обеспечить согласованность данных.
Доп. материал: Предположим, у нас есть база данных студентов и их оценок. Если мы установим режим автоматического сохранения изменений, то любые изменения в оценках студентов будут автоматически сохраняться в базе данных без дополнительных действий.
Совет: Чтобы лучше понять эти режимы, рекомендуется прочитать документацию или учебные материалы по выбранной системе управления базами данных. Это поможет вам применять эти режимы наиболее эффективно и избегать потенциальных ошибок.
Упражнение: Какой режим следует выбрать, если необходимо обновлять все ссылки на значение, если оно было изменено в базе данных?
Объяснение: При установке связи в базе данных, есть несколько настраиваемых режимов доступа. Рассмотрим каждый из них подробнее.
1) Режим автоматического сохранения изменений: Этот режим позволяет автоматически сохранять изменения, сделанные в базе данных. Например, если вы внесли изменения в таблицу, такие как добавление, удаление или изменение записей, то эти изменения автоматически сохранятся в базе данных без необходимости явно выполнять команду сохранения.
2) Режим автоматического удаления связанных объектов: Данный режим позволяет автоматически удалять связанные объекты в базе данных при удалении родительского объекта. Например, если у вас есть таблица "Категории" и таблица "Товары", связанные между собой, то при удалении категории все товары, связанные с этой категорией, будут автоматически удалены без необходимости явно выполнять команду удаления.
3) Режим автоматической замены связанных значений: Этот режим позволяет автоматически заменять значения полей, связанных между собой, при изменении родительского значения. Например, если у вас есть таблица "Заказы" и таблица "Клиенты", связанные между собой через поле "КлиентID", то при изменении значения "КлиентID" в таблице "Клиенты", все связанные заказы автоматически обновятся соответствующими значениями.
Демонстрация: При работе с базой данных, вы можете установить один или несколько из вышеупомянутых режимов, в зависимости от требований вашего проекта или задачи.
Совет: При настройке связей в базе данных, важно тщательно использовать эти режимы и быть осторожными, чтобы избежать потери данных или неожиданного поведения системы. Рекомендуется настраивать режимы в соответствии с требованиями вашего проекта и проводить тестирование перед внедрением изменений.
Задача для проверки: Какие настройки режимов доступны при установке связи в базе данных? Опишите каждый режим подробно и дайте пример использования каждого из них.